'O. Henry Encore' Summary
The collection 'O. Henry Encore' presents a trove of early works by the celebrated American writer O. Henry, penned under the pseudonym "Post Man." These pieces, initially published in the Houston Post between 1895 and 1896, offer a captivating window into the nascent stages of his literary career. The stories, sketches, and poems within showcase a young O. Henry experimenting with his signature wit, narrative style, and insightful observations of human nature. The collection's discovery adds an intriguing layer to O. Henry's biography, as these writings were unearthed decades later while conducting research for a university thesis. They provide a glimpse into the writer's life before he gained fame and faced legal troubles that led him to flee to Honduras in 1896. 'O. Henry Encore' allows readers to trace the evolution of the writer's craft and witness the genesis of the distinctive storytelling style that would later solidify his legacy as a master of American literature.Book Details
